Subject: DR drill — ScanBridge

Running the disaster-recovery drill for the ScanBridge barcode scanner integration Thursday. Your part: review the failover branch before then. We'll kill the Orrick ingest node, confirm scans queue locally, and replay them after restore. Expect thirty minutes of degraded mode. Flag anything sketchy in the replay logic by Wednesday noon. Restoring the drill vault needs the passphrase below.

recovery phrase for bawef-haduf: wenax-druox-julmir

## Deployment

Quillfax renders PDF invoices for all Bramblehook tenants. Deploy only from tagged releases, and confirm the font bundle matches the release notes before restarting workers, since mismatched glyph sets silently corrupt totals. After the restart, verify a sample invoice renders in under two seconds. The current production configuration values are listed below.

service settings:
[briius]
port = 3000
region = outer-1
host = briius.zarqeldyn.internal
team = wenael
timeout_ms = 2000
retries = 5

Subject: DR drill — Lanterbrook invoice renderer

Team, during Thursday's disaster-recovery drill the Lanterbrook PDF invoice renderer will fail over to the Coldmere standby cluster. Customers may see a ten-minute delay on invoice downloads; please use the prepared macro when responding. Support leads should verify the standby renders a sample invoice before we declare success. To unseal the standby's signing store during the drill, use the recovery passphrase shown below.

unlock words, yawig-kagef: gordor-holvan-ulaael-pramir-ulaiel-tamdor

## Tuning

Quick context for review: we moved the old cron jobs into Loomhaven's workflow engine, and most of the weirdness you'll see in this diff is retry semantics. Cron just fired and forgot; Loomhaven retries with backoff, so a few jobs that were accidentally idempotent now need to be actually idempotent. I kept the schedules identical for now to make diffing runs easier. Concurrency caps are conservative until we watch a full week. Here are the knobs I landed on after three staging runs.

constants for bawif-kawif:
QUOTAS = {
    "ulaael": 5,
    "holael": 10,
}